创建一个Laravel项目。错误'..requirements无法解析为一组可安装的程序包‘

我正在尝试创建一个laravel项目。我正在参考它的网站上提供的文档。在我提供这个命令之后

代码语言:javascript
复制
composer create-project --prefer-dist laravel/laravel blog

当我尝试这样做的时候,我得到了这些错误。我是新来Laravel的。我已经严格遵循了所有步骤来设置一个laravel项目,但现在我被这个问题所困扰。我在谷歌上搜索了这个错误后,找不到解决方案。

代码语言:javascript
复制
Updating dependencies (including require-dev)
Your requirements could not be resolved to an installable set of packages.

  Problem 1
- laravel/framework v5.2.9 requires symfony/http-foundation 2.8.*|3.0.* -> satisfiable by symfony/http-foundation[2.8.x-dev, 3.0.x-dev] but these conflict with your requirements or minimum-stability.
